St. Boniface councillor Dan Vandal will roll up his sleeves this afternoon to clean up green space in his ward.
Vandal and local students will be cleaning up the neighbourhood as part of the inaugural St. Boniface Community Clean-Up. Sixty Grade 7 and 8 students from Collège Louis-Riel will assist in the clean-up.
Students will be picking up litter along Provencher Boulevard and Provencher Park from 1:30 p.m. to 3:45 p.m.
A second clean-up will also be taking place on May 25 in Windsor Park with students from Collège Béliveau. On this route, students will be picking up litter in Vincent Massey Park.
